@zenquester38963 ай бұрын
how do you bleed out the lines? I did this fix and still have same issue.
@metal422life3 ай бұрын
@@zenquester3896 you just hold down the trigger with no tip on the gun so that it's just water flowing and you just want to have it so that no more air bubbles are going through. You will hear a good amount of them at first and after the bubbles slow down kind of like making popcorn I guess you hear the popping slow down that's when it's pretty much done

With mine, same Karcher 2400psi model, the need to clean and lube the unloader valve comes again and again, eventually you have to replace it. Amz or flea bay has 'em for $20, it's the green one. It is designed to open if the pump is not being used and the water gets too hot, but they start sticking. Also called a "Spill Valve".
